Short bio

Sandra Köhler studied Industrial Engineering at the University of Augsburg. Her majors included "Materials Resource Management" and "Management and Sustainability". Since February 2017, she has been a research associate at the Chair of Production & Supply Chain Management.

She wrote her dissertation in the field of "Industrial Ecology". Specifically, her research focuses on the preparation for reuse of waste electrical equipment. The methods used include material flow analysis and life cycle assessment.

In teaching, Mrs. Köhler is responsible for the course "Introduction to Economics" as well as seminars in the area of resource strategies and SAP.
